Few More

I told Reckless that it "pains" me to say this, but the detail level and rigging of the F4 looks great. The throttles are tough to work well, but I understand that is going to be changed.
It looks like it came from a differnt MFG. I think Sunsation has a winner. Now the question is: how will it hold up?

I felt the same way about the throttles when I first started using the boat. But after awhile I got to feel like they were well placed for throttling from half to full. I still feel like I am reaching back for them from idle to half.

Thanks for the compliments though. I agree with you, time will tell on how it stands up in this level market.
